Attending childcare for the first time: our tips for parents

Starting childcare can be a big step – for both you and your child. Whether they’re a baby or toddler, it’s natural to wonder how they’ll adjust to new faces, routines, and surroundings. Maybe your child has had reflux or is going through a clingy phase.

I am not a Tourist in Rotterdam

Rotterdam, the gateway to Europe. International city with a distinct character, energetic, always in motion, its eyes on the future. It’s no wonder that more and more companies and internationals settle and build their future here.
